thinkgeo.mapsuite.webapiedition.layeroverlay

This is an old revision of the document!


ThinkGeo.MapSuite.WebApiEdition.LayerOverlay

<!– Class –>

Inheritance Hierarchy

Members Summary

Public Constructors

Name Parameters DeclaringType Summary
Public MethodLayerOverlay
Public MethodLayerOverlay String
Public MethodLayerOverlay IEnumerable<Layer>
Public MethodLayerOverlay String, IEnumerable<Layer>
Public MethodLayerOverlay String, IEnumerable<Layer>, BitmapTileCache

Protected Constructors

Name Parameters DeclaringType Summary

Public Methods

Name Parameters DeclaringType Summary
Public MethodDraw GeoCanvas Overlay
Public MethodEquals Object Object
Public MethodGetHashCode Object
Public MethodGetType Object
Public MethodToString Object

Protected Methods

Public Properties

Protected Properties

Name Return DeclaringType Summary

Public Events

Public Constructors

LayerOverlay()

Parameters

Name Type Description

Go Back

LayerOverlay(String)

Parameters

Name Type Description
Id String<!– System.String –>

Go Back

LayerOverlay(IEnumerable<Layer>)

Parameters

Name Type Description
layers IEnumerable<Layer><!– System.Collections.Generic.IEnumerable{ThinkGeo.MapSuite.Core.Layer} –>

Go Back

LayerOverlay(String, IEnumerable<Layer>)

Parameters

Name Type Description
Id String<!– System.String –>
layers IEnumerable<Layer><!– System.Collections.Generic.IEnumerable{ThinkGeo.MapSuite.Core.Layer} –>

Go Back

LayerOverlay(String, IEnumerable<Layer>, BitmapTileCache)

Parameters

Name Type Description
Id String<!– System.String –>
layers IEnumerable<Layer><!– System.Collections.Generic.IEnumerable{ThinkGeo.MapSuite.Core.Layer} –>
tileCache BitmapTileCache<!– ThinkGeo.MapSuite.Core.BitmapTileCache –>

Go Back

Protected Constructors

Public Methods

Draw(GeoCanvas)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
geoCanvas GeoCanvas<!– ThinkGeo.MapSuite.Core.GeoCanvas –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

Equals(Object)

Return Value

Return Type Description
Boolean<!– System.Boolean –>

Parameters

Name Type Description
obj Object<!– System.Object –>

<!– System.Object –> Go Back

GetHashCode()

Return Value

Return Type Description
Int32<!– System.Int32 –>

Parameters

Name Type Description

<!– System.Object –> Go Back

GetType()

Return Value

Return Type Description
Type<!– System.Type –>

Parameters

Name Type Description

<!– System.Object –> Go Back

ToString()

Return Value

Return Type Description
String<!– System.String –>

Parameters

Name Type Description

<!– System.Object –> Go Back

Protected Methods

DrawCore(GeoCanvas)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
geoCanvas GeoCanvas<!– ThinkGeo.MapSuite.Core.GeoCanvas –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ay(overriden) –> Go Back

DrawException(GeoCanvas, Exception)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
geoCanvas GeoCanvas<!– ThinkGeo.MapSuite.Core.GeoCanvas –>
e Exception<!– System.Exception –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

DrawExceptionCore(GeoCanvas, Exception)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
geoCanvas GeoCanvas<!– ThinkGeo.MapSuite.Core.GeoCanvas –>
e Exception<!– System.Exception –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

Finalize()

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description

<!– System.Object –> Go Back

MemberwiseClone()

Return Value

Return Type Description
Object<!– System.Object –>

Parameters

Name Type Description

<!– System.Object –> Go Back

OnDrawing(DrawingOverlayEventArgs)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
e DrawingO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awingO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

OnDrawingLayer(DrawingLayerOverlayEventArgs)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
e DrawingLayerO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awingLayerO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.LayerOverlay –> Go Back

OnDrawn(DrawnOverlayEventArgs)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
e DrawnO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awnO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

OnDrawnLayer(DrawnLayerOverlayEventArgs)

Return Value

Return Type Description
Void<!– System.Void –>

Parameters

Name Type Description
e DrawnLayerO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awnLayerO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.LayerOverlay –> Go Back

Public Properties

DrawingExceptionMode

Return Value

Return Type
DrawingExceptionMode<!– ThinkGeo.MapSuite.Core.DrawingExceptionMode –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

Id

Return Value

Return Type
String<!– System.String –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

IsVisible

Return Value

Return Type
Boolean<!– System.Boolean –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

Layers

Return Value

Return Type
GeoCollection<Layer><!– ThinkGeo.MapSuite.Core.GeoCollection{ThinkGeo.MapSuite.Core.Layer} –>

<!– ThinkGeo.MapSuite.WebApiEdition.LayerOverlay –> Go Back

TileCache

Return Value

Return Type
BitmapTileCache<!– ThinkGeo.MapSuite.Core.BitmapTileCache –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

Protected Properties

Public Events

Drawing

Event Arguments

Event Arguments
DrawingO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awingO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

DrawingLayer

Event Arguments

Event Arguments
DrawingLayerO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awingLayerO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.LayerOverlay –> Go Back

Drawn

Event Arguments

Event Arguments
DrawnO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awnO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.Overlay –> Go Back

DrawnLayer

Event Arguments

Event Arguments
DrawnLayerOverlayEventArgs<!– ThinkGeo.MapSuite.WebApiEdition.DrawnLayerOverlayEventArgs –>

<!– ThinkGeo.MapSuite.WebApiEdition.LayerOverlay –> Go Back

NOTOC WebApiEdition ThinkGeo.MapSuite.WebApiEdition UpdateDocumentation

thinkgeo.mapsuite.webapiedition.layeroverlay.1440040135.txt.gz · Last modified: 2015/09/18 10:53 (external edit)